8073 27

[其他] [讨论]国王和100个犯人的问题,给出我的解法,大家提提意见 [推广有奖]

21
liuc2008 发表于 2010-7-20 18:08:58
有意思,想到答案后传上来

22
郑立 发表于 2010-7-21 14:53:32
大家写任何数字,似的概率都是1%

23
porno 发表于 2010-7-21 15:25:31
有点意思 想到了再上传答案。貌似跟国王的心情有关,如果没有重复,那自然很好办了。如果有1个重复,又要复杂点了。最麻烦的是有50个重复了……还有不允许传递任何讯息,是不是包括不能以任何方式提示与对方数字的大小或范围有关的一切举动。

24
sunlaoqq 发表于 2010-10-13 18:51:06
设100个囚犯头上数字的和为sum;第N个囚犯头上数字为 Pn ( 1 <= Pn <= 100 ),除第 N 个囚犯数字和为Tn,则 sum = Pn + Tn,则 Pn = sum - Tn 成立,即 Pn - 1 = sum - Tn - 1。因为 0 <= Pn - 1 <= 99,所以 ( Pn - 1 )%100 = Pn - 1 = sum%100 - Tn%100 - 1,也即 Pn = sum%100 - Tn%100。
    因为 0 <= sum%100 <= 99,sum%100是唯一的,令:
        第一个犯人:P1 = -( T1 % 100 ) + 0
        第二个犯人:P2 = -( T2 % 100 ) + 1
        ...
        第100个犯人:P100 = -( T100 % 100 ) + 99
    则 Pn 中必有一个是某囚犯自己头上的数字,完毕。

25
吾成昊 发表于 2010-10-13 19:40:00
他们写数字是在看了对方的编号之后吗  那样的话就好点

26
sunlaoqq 发表于 2010-10-13 20:09:00
如果是之前的话,那连数字是什么都不知道了,这样就必然做不出来了啊。
不过头上的数字要是1~100之中随机的才行吧。啊啊,晕了。

27
kingzhifeng 发表于 2010-10-14 14:36:31
我觉得他们这100个人商量时应该确定一个人,所有的人都写同一个数字,那就有100%的把握。比如大家确定1号作为目标吧,除了1号外其余99个人都能看到1号头上的数字,其他99个人都写1号头上的数字,这样1号看到好多相同 的数字,也写和大家一样的数字不就得了吗

28
iloveyouye 发表于 2010-10-14 16:36:06
kingzhifeng 发表于 2010-10-14 14:36
我觉得他们这100个人商量时应该确定一个人,所有的人都写同一个数字,那就有100%的把握。比如大家确定1号作为目标吧,除了1号外其余99个人都能看到1号头上的数字,其他99个人都写1号头上的数字,这样1号看到好多相同 的数字,也写和大家一样的数字不就得了吗
1号看到另外99个人的数字不就等于传递信息了

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注jr
拉您进交流群
GMT+8, 2025-12-25 09:20